Patty Mills signs 2-year deal with Portland Blazers

Aussie Patrick Mills signs with Portland TrailblazersAfter injuring himself in the beginning of training camp, turning down offers from Europe, Patty Mills’ hard work and patience has paid off after signing a two-year deal with the Portland Trailblazers.

“It feels like I finally got the gorilla off my back.” Mills said. “It was a massive gorilla and there were times when I thought I wasn’t going to make it, but finally I’ve got rid of it and now I just want to be part of the team.”

“This is amazing, it’s such a good feeling,” said Mills.

Mill was drafted 55th overall by the Blazers in the 2009 NBA Draft, but injured himself July 9th,

The 15th and final roster spot came down to Mills, Nigerian international Ime Udoka and Jarron Collins. With NBA active rosters of 12, Mills could be starting with the  Iowa Stampede, Portland’s NDBL team.

The NBA season begins Tuesday, October 27, 2009.
